Faster Loading That Keeps You in the Game
Slots lose momentum when they take too long to load. An optimized casino app reduces the wait from lobby to reels by preloading key assets and caching frequently used elements. You experience the first spin quickly, with the game staying responsive after your input. This matters because many slots load high-resolution symbols, effects, and sound layers that can strain a phone.
Mobile now accounts for the largest share of global games revenue, according to a global games market sales estimate, so the difference between a slow slot load and a fast one becomes more than a minor annoyance. It shapes how long players stay in a game and how often they switch.
Faster loading supports better decisions. You can check paytables, RTP notes when available, and bonus rules quickly. By minimizing interface delays, you avoid rushed spins and retain full control over pacing, allowing you to spend your session actively on the reels.
Optimization also improves game switching. You can switch between online slot machines seamlessly, without slow transitions or repeated loading screens. This efficiency is especially helpful when exploring different volatility profiles or evaluating feature mechanics such as expanding wilds or hold-and-spin rounds.

Tap Accuracy for Bet Size, Spin, and Autoplay Control
Slots demand precise control. You adjust coin value, lines, or stake tiers, and one wrong tap can change your risk level. Optimization improves touch handling so the app registers taps accurately and avoids double inputs. This reduces accidental max bets and unwanted fast spins.
Control matters even more with autoplay and quick spin settings. A responsive interface lets you set the right number of spins, stop conditions, and speed preferences without lag. App delays may hinder timely cancellation of autoplay, affecting feature responses or stake adjustments.
An optimized slot UI also places the most used controls where your thumb reaches comfortably. Spin, bet adjustment, and menu access remain easy to use in one-hand mode. This helps when you play on the move. It also reduces fatigue during longer sessions. For players, tap accuracy is not a minor detail. It protects bankroll control and supports consistent play. It also makes every spin feel intentional.
Battery, Heat, and Visual Clarity for Long Slot Sessions
Slots consume significant battery power due to continuous animation, sound, and frequent user interactions. Optimization reduces power use by managing refresh rates, limiting background activity, and rendering effects efficiently, which matters because smartphones with better battery performance deliver longer, smoother sessions.
Heat affects performance. When a device gets hot, it may throttle speed, which can cause lag and stutter. Optimized apps reduce this problem by controlling resource spikes during heavy scenes, especially in bonus rounds with multiple layers of effects.
Visual clarity matters too. On a small screen, poor scaling can make payline highlights, win amounts, and feature counters hard to read. Optimization improves text rendering and layout so you can see stake, balance, and feature progress at a glance.

These improvements support smarter play. You track bankroll changes accurately, you spot when a slot shifts into a feature mode, and you can decide when to stop or switch games. Comfort and clarity increase enjoyment and reduce mistakes.
